Gaming Facebook Marketplace Recommendations

If you're serious about scoring deals on Gaming Facebook Marketplace, here are a few recommendations to keep in mind. First, prioritize safety. Always meet sellers in a public place during daylight hours, and bring a friend along if possible. Before handing over any cash, thoroughly inspect the item you're buying and test it if possible. If you're buying a PC component, ask the seller to demonstrate that it's working properly in their system.

Second, do your research. Before making an offer on an item, check its retail price and research its specifications. This will help you determine if the asking price is fair and ensure that the item meets your needs. Also, be wary of listings that seem too good to be true. If a deal seems unbelievably low, it's likely a scam.

Third, be communicative. Ask the seller questions about the item's condition, history, and any potential issues. A good seller will be transparent and willing to provide detailed information. If a seller is evasive or unwilling to answer your questions, it's a red flag. Remember to be patient and polite throughout the process. Building rapport with the seller can increase your chances of getting a good deal and avoiding potential problems. How to spot red flags while Gaming Facebook Marketplace

Navigating the digital landscape of Facebook Marketplace to acquire gaming gear requires a vigilant eye for potential pitfalls. Red flags can appear in various forms, from suspiciously low prices to vague product descriptions, and recognizing these signs is crucial to protecting yourself from scams and unsatisfactory purchases. One of the most glaring red flags is a price that seems too good to be true. Scammers often lure unsuspecting buyers with incredibly low prices to entice them into making a quick decision without proper scrutiny. Always compare the listed price with the average market value of the item. If it's significantly lower, proceed with extreme caution.

Another red flag is a seller who is unwilling to provide detailed information or clear photos of the item. A legitimate seller should be able to answer your questions about the product's condition, history, and functionality. If the seller is evasive, provides vague answers, or refuses to provide additional photos, it's a sign that they may be hiding something. Inconsistent stories or reluctance to meet in a public place are also major warning signs. Scammers often prefer to communicate solely through messaging and avoid face-to-face interactions.

Finally, trust your instincts. If something feels off about the seller or the listing, it's best to err on the side of caution. There are plenty of legitimate sellers on Facebook Marketplace, so don't feel pressured to buy from someone you're not comfortable with. Essential Tips for Gaming Facebook Marketplace

Success on Gaming Facebook Marketplace hinges on a few key strategies. First and foremost, master the art of the search. Use specific keywords to narrow down your results and save time. Instead of simply searching for "graphics card," try "RTX 3070 for sale" or "used gaming PC." This will help you find exactly what you're looking for and avoid sifting through irrelevant listings.

Another essential tip is to check the seller's profile. Look for signs of legitimacy, such as a profile picture, a history of posts, and positive reviews from other buyers. Be wary of profiles that are recently created or have limited activity. Also, don't hesitate to ask for references or to connect with other buyers who have purchased from the seller in the past.

Negotiation is a crucial skill for success on Facebook Marketplace. Don't be afraid to make an offer, even if it's lower than the asking price. Many sellers are willing to negotiate, especially if they're looking to sell an item quickly. However, be respectful and reasonable with your offers. Lowballing can offend sellers and damage your chances of getting a good deal. Before making an offer, research the market value of the item to determine a fair price. Remember, the goal is to find a win-win situation where both you and the seller are happy with the transaction. Finally, always inspect the item thoroughly before finalizing the purchase. If possible, test it to ensure that it's working properly. How to Get Started with Gaming Facebook Marketplace

Getting started with Gaming Facebook Marketplace is a straightforward process. First, ensure you have a Facebook account. If you don't, creating one is quick and easy. Once you're logged in, navigate to the Marketplace icon, which is typically located in the left-hand menu or at the bottom of the screen on mobile devices. From there, you can start browsing listings or create your own.

To find gaming equipment, use the search bar at the top of the Marketplace page. Enter specific keywords, such as "gaming PC," "Nintendo Switch," or "RTX 3080." You can also use filters to narrow down your results based on price, location, and condition. When browsing listings, pay close attention to the item descriptions, photos, and seller ratings. If you have any questions, don't hesitate to contact the seller directly through the messaging system.

To sell gaming equipment, click on the "Create New Listing" button. Choose the "Item for Sale" option and fill out the required information, including the item's title, description, price, and condition. Upload clear photos that showcase the item's features and any potential flaws. Be honest and accurate in your descriptions to avoid misunderstandings. Once your listing is created, it will be visible to other users in your area. Respond promptly to inquiries and be prepared to negotiate. What if Things Go Wrong on Gaming Facebook Marketplace?

Despite your best efforts, things can sometimes go wrong on Gaming Facebook Marketplace. If you encounter a problem, such as receiving a damaged item or being scammed, there are steps you can take to resolve the issue. First, contact the seller directly and try to resolve the problem amicably. Explain the situation clearly and calmly, and be prepared to provide evidence, such as photos or screenshots.

If you're unable to reach a resolution with the seller, you can report the issue to Facebook. To do this, navigate to the seller's profile or the listing and click on the "Report Listing" or "Report Profile" option. Provide a detailed explanation of the problem and any supporting evidence. Facebook will investigate the issue and take appropriate action, which may include removing the listing, suspending the seller's account, or providing a refund.

If you paid for the item using a credit card or Pay Pal, you may be able to file a dispute with your payment provider. Explain the situation and provide any supporting evidence. Your payment provider will investigate the issue and may be able to recover your funds. In severe cases, such as if you've been a victim of fraud, you may need to file a police report. Be sure to keep all records of your communications with the seller, as well as any evidence of the transaction. Question and Answer

Q: Is it safe to buy gaming equipment on Facebook Marketplace?

A: Buying on Facebook Marketplace involves some risk, but you can mitigate it by meeting sellers in public places, inspecting items thoroughly before purchasing, and paying with secure methods like Pay Pal. Always trust your gut and walk away if something feels off.

Q: What are the best ways to find good deals on gaming equipment?

A: Use specific keywords in your searches, join local gaming groups on Facebook, and set up notifications for new listings. Be patient, persistent, and don't be afraid to negotiate.

Q: How can I avoid getting scammed on Facebook Marketplace?

A: Be wary of listings that seem too good to be true, avoid sellers who are unwilling to meet in person or provide detailed information, and never send money before receiving the item.

Q: What should I do if I have a problem with a purchase on Facebook Marketplace?

A: First, try to resolve the issue directly with the seller. If that doesn't work, report the issue to Facebook and consider filing a dispute with your payment provider.
